An infant was killed and the parents injured in an apparent dog attack at a home in Woodbridge Township, New Jersey. The mother and child sustained serious injuries from the family dog, and the baby was pronounced dead at the scene. The investigation is ongoing, and authorities have not disclosed the breed of the dog. This incident adds to the statistics of fatal dog attacks involving young children in the United States.
St. Louis Cardinals pitcher Adam Wainwright, who recently retired from baseball, was surprised with a Lagotto Romagnolo puppy named Louie during a ceremony before his final game with the team. Wainwright had promised his children a family dog upon his retirement, and the Cardinals fulfilled that promise. The emotional ceremony included former teammates and players giving speeches to honor Wainwright's career.
A 2-year-old girl in Michigan who wandered away from her home was found hours later in the woods, asleep on one of her family dogs like a pillow, while the other dog kept her safe. The girl was found about 3 miles from her home by a citizen on an ATV and appeared to be in good health after being checked by medical staff.

Country singer Morgan Wallen's 2-year-old son was bitten in the face by the family's Great Pyrenees dog. Wallen's ex-fiancé KT Smith, who got the dog last year, revealed the incident on Instagram and said that the dog, named Legend, will not be euthanized but instead will be given to a new family without young children. Wallen has recently been cleared to return to performing after canceling six weeks of shows due to a vocal fold trauma.
Former Bachelor star Sean Lowe and his wife Catherine Giudice Lowe have rehomed their dog, Gus, after he bit their daughter Mia and son Samuel, who required a trip to the hospital. Despite Gus being a "great dog" and "well-trained," Sean explained that he had shown "a couple instances of resource guarding" in the past. The couple attempted to have Gus further trained but ultimately decided to rehome him to protect their children. Gus is now living with a dog trainer and doing well. The Lowes are taking a break before getting another dog.
